Karr: Cigar-butt investing is profitable but difficult to scale

Adam Carr · Adam Karr: The Investing Blueprint · Nov 12, 2024 · at 4:34

Adam Karr discusses Warren Buffett's strategic evolution away from classic cigar-butt deep value investing as Berkshire Hathaway's asset base expanded.

“And so if you're playing cigar butts which can be very profitable. But it's difficult to scale that. And so as his capital grew over time, you know, you have to think about how you show up and how you approach it.”
